What to Look for in a Modern Cottage Bathroom
As an owner of a cottage, the same rules that apply to a home or apartment don’t apply to the cottage when it comes to its bathroom and kitchen. For one thing, you have less space available to create these welcoming, yet practical spaces, and it is even more important for you to maximise every bit of space available.
You will be hard pressed to find anything cosier than a rustic, country-feel cottage bathroom. Low ceilings and inviting alcoves are the norm for most cottage bathrooms, and can really help to make the space feel more unique and interesting, especially if your cottage offers rustic features, such as exposed beams.

Less Tends to Be More
When it comes to the design of cottage bathrooms, there is a general rule of thumb, which is that less is more. Simplicity really is key here if you want to create a look that is harmonious with the space. This is especially true for a room that features timber floors or exposed beams, both of which can end up really dominating a space.
Many cottage bathrooms also tend to be smaller in size, and this is often emphasised by the shape of the room, as well as other aspects, such as low ceilings, eaves and sloping ceilings. If, like many cottage owners, you have limited space to work with, the last thing you want is for your bathroom design to end up feeling cluttered.
Neutral Colours
Another expert tip to helping you get the most out of your bathroom space is to keep colours neutral. Cottage bathrooms tend to flourish with neutral colours, as they complement the overall style of the rest of the property. Cottages with existing features, such as exposed beams or timber floors, exude a natural and effortless rustic style, which should also be reflected in its décor.
You can easily accentuate these features with neutral coloured furniture and exciting accessories to help create a truly country cottage appeal. Many South African cottages, by design, also tend to have smaller windows, which lets in little to no natural light. Use neutral tones along with off-white colours to create a lighter and breezier space.
